Auckland's Kristin School is the winner of the Reserve Bank of New Zealand Monetary Policy Challenge.
Tauranga Boys' College was second and Scots College from Wellington came third.
The challenge is designed to expand senior secondary school economics students' understanding of monetary policy.
The national final took place at the central bank in Wellington yesterday.
Kristin School won $2500 in prize money and will visit the Reserve Bank on September 16 to watch the announcement of the next Monetary Policy Statement by Governor Alan Bollard.
Tauranga Boys' College won $1500 and Scot's College won $750 in prize money for their respective schools. The other competitors in the national final were St Kentigern College of Auckland, Christchurch Girls' College and Timaru Boys' High School.
